The Detroit Lions made a big move Monday, trading veteran running back David Montgomery to the Houston Texans. In a deal that landed the Lions two picks and a veteran offensive lineman in Juice Scruggs, the Lions officiall disbanded what had been one of the more productive backfield duos in recent years of Montgomery and Jahmyr Gibbs.
After consistent reports of running back David Montgomery getting shopped, a deal finally broke on Monday. The Detroit Lions sent the 28-year-old to Houston for a 2026 fourth-round pick, a 2027 seventh-round pick, and interior offensive lineman Juice Scruggs.

The Detroit Lions released starting offensive lineman Graham Glasgow on Monday. The Lions are expected to save $5.5 million against the cap with the move, which came hours after they traded running back David Montgomery to the Houston Texans.

Graham Glasgow will not remain in place with the Lions for 2026. The veteran offensive lineman was released on Monday, per a team announcement. Glasgow had been mentioned as a likely cut candidate dating back to January, so today’s news comes as little surprise.
